What is the maximum CGPA in Calicut University?

This table shows the Seven Point Indirect Grading System used by the University of Calicut for undergraduate courses. Note: SGPA and CGPA shall be rounded off by two decimal places….Cumulative GPA Calculator (U Calicut)

Letter Percentage Points
A+ 90-100 6
A 80-89.99 5
B 70-79.99 4
C 60-69.99 3

How many seats are available in Calicut University?

Calicut University is the largest Affiliating University in Kerala with 229 Government, Aided and Self-financing colleges functioning under its affiliation. Calicut University offers Admission to 65,997 Seats in various Undergraduate, Postgraduate and Doctoral programs.

What type of University is Calicut University?

collegiate state public university
The University of Calicut, also known as Calicut University, is a collegiate state public university in Malappuram District located in northern Kerala, India.

What is the rank of Calicut University in the world?

University of Calicut Ranking Highlights

Ranking Year Ranked At
Outlook 2019 40th out of 100
QS India Universities 2020 45th out of 100
BRICS 2019 158th out of 400
Asian Universities Ranking 2020 401-450th out of 550

How many students are there in Calicut University?

Calicut University caters to more than 2.75 lakh students each year and is the largest affiliating university in the state of Kerala. The university offers Undergraduate, Postgraduate and Ph.D. courses in both Full-Time and Distance Mode.

What is the admission procedure for MBA in Calicut University?

Calicut University conducts the Calicut University Management Aptitude Test (CU MAT) to offer admission to MBA in both full-time and part-time modes. GPAT and GATE score is mandatory for M.Pharm and M.Tech courses respectively.
